Output e690376b2aae794900b7d19d114f17c090f8dfe0c74800a1f7fc1bb776f63b09:0

value
584045924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d2fdd92a593c961cef6d4105273bc99d425ab53 OP_EQUAL
address
32tk3ntuEk7PaDVCqT3kLnvmrfWSnUXNcy
transaction
e690376b2aae794900b7d19d114f17c090f8dfe0c74800a1f7fc1bb776f63b09
spent
true